Introduction:

In the present fast-paced world, the standard 9-5 working arrangements no more pertains to numerous households. Because of the rise of dual-income households and non-traditional work hours, the interest in 24-hour daycare services was steadily increasing. 24-hour daycare facilities offer moms and dads the flexibleness they should balance work and family members responsibilities, and provide a safe and nurturing environment for the kids around-the-clock.

Advantages of 24-Hour Daycare:

Among key great things about 24-hour daycare may be the freedom it offers working parents. Many parents work changes that offer beyond traditional daycare hours, rendering it difficult to acquire childcare that suits their particular schedule. 24-hour daycare centers solve this problem by giving attention during nights, vacations, plus in a single day. This allows moms and dads to focus without worrying all about finding anyone to watch kids during non-traditional hours.

Another advantage of 24-hour daycare could be the peace of mind it provides to parents. Realizing that their children are now being cared for by trained specialists in a secure and protected environment can relieve the anxiety and guilt that often is sold with making children in daycare. Moms and dads can consider their work realizing that kids have been in good arms, which could induce increased productivity and job pleasure.

Additionally, 24-hour daycare facilities provides a sense of neighborhood and help for people. Moms and dads which work non-traditional hours often battle to find childcare options that meet their demands, ultimately causing feelings of isolation and stress. 24-hour daycare facilities can provide a sense of that belong and camaraderie among parents facing similar challenges, creating a support community that can help households thrive.

Difficulties of 24-Hour Daycare:

While 24-hour daycare facilities offer benefits, additionally they come with their collection of difficulties. One of the greatest difficulties is staffing. Finding qualified and reliable childcare providers who're willing to work non-traditional hours could be hard, resulting in large turnover rates and prospective staffing shortages. This will impact the grade of treatment supplied to children and produce instability for people relying on 24-hour daycare solutions.

Regulation and Oversight:

To ensure the security and wellbeing of kids in 24-hour daycare facilities, regulation and supervision are necessary. State and regional governments set criteria for certification and certification of daycare centers, including the ones that run twenty-four hours a day. These standards cover a wide range of places, including staff-to-child ratios, safety and health needs, and staff training and skills.

Along with government regulations, numerous 24-hour daycare facilities choose to look for certification from nationwide businesses including the National Association when it comes to knowledge of children (NAEYC) or even the National Association for Family childcare (NAFCC). Accreditation demonstrates dedication to top-quality care and will assist parents feel confident in their chosen childcare supplier.
